Star Wars “The Last Jedi” Christmas Exhibition

The Star Wars The Last Jedi Exhibition basically has two different parts. The first part features full life-size statues (1:1 characters) of the upcoming Episode 8 movie. You can take pictures with Kylo Ren, Captain Phasma and an Elite Praetorian Guard.

In addition, there are also First Order Tie Fighter models. You are missing Stroomtroopers? No problem. The exhibition features the newly introduced First Order Judicial Executioner Stormtroopers. You can imagine that not only true Star Wars fans are getting crazy to get a picture taken with the new Stormtroopers.

LEGO x Star Wars The Last Jedi Exhibition 2017

The second part is a specific LEGO x Star Wars The Last Jedi Exhibition. The previous LEGO x Star Wars “The Force Awakens” Exhibition at the Times Square Shopping Mall in Causeway Bay had been very popular. Hence, it is no wonder that apm choose to display a specific LEGO related Christmas decorations.

The heart of the LEGO exhibition is a 10 meter long Kylo Ren Tie Fighter made out of LEGO. A LEGO life-size Kylo Ren and a Tie Fighter Pilot figure are just standing in front of the Kylo Ren’s Tie Fighter.

Kylo Ren’s Tie Fighter is surrounded by several unique LEGO sculptures and models. Over 100,000 bricks have been used to create LEGO life-sized Star Wars 1:1 characters.

LEGO x Star Wars “The Last Jedi” Characters

All-time favorite C3PO consists of 16487 bricks, weights around 35kg and took 135 hours to build. The model size is 172 x 100 x 60 cm.

R2-D2 weights 48 kg, is made out of 22781 bricks and took 130 hours to build. The model is is 107 x 74 x 82 cm.

The model of BB-8 took 25 hours to build, weights 27 kg and is made of 31850 bricks. The dimensions are 70 x 64 x 64 cm.

The Last Jedi has a new droid called BB9E. This LEGO model consists of 13812 bricks, weights 25 kg and took 42 hours to complete. The dimensions are 70 x 64 x 64 cm.

The Clone Trooper size is 180 x 123 x 123 cm. It took 115 hours and 24180 bricks to build this life-size LEGO model.

Just next to the Clone Trooper you find the life-size LEGO model of Kylo Ren (210 x 125 x 125 cm). The 80 kg LEGO Kylo Ren took 210 hours and 37606 bricks.

Finally, there are two Star Wars inspired LEGO Christmas trees. The Christmas tree features small versions of the First Order Tie Fighters as well as a special edition of the new BB9E character wearing a Santa Clause head.
